java - JAX-WS,为什么收到的LinkedHashMap集合是空的?

标签 java linkedhashmap

我正在构建一个java webservice,它接收LinkedHashMap作为参数。 LinkedHashMap 集合在客户端插入了一些元素,但我在 Web 服务中收到的元素是空的。

最佳答案

Avoid returning collections directly. Instead of returning a List<X>, return a JavaBean that has a List<X> in it. This will give you more detailed control over the marshalling anyway.

Producing a Web Service with JAX-WS and JAXB

另请参阅:

关于java - JAX-WS,为什么收到的LinkedHashMap集合是空的?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12905315/

相关文章:

java - 无法读取另一个可分割对象中的可分割对象

java - 泄漏 (SWT & RCP) : Device is not tracking resource allocation (eclipse 4. 3)

java - 在android中使用共享首选项存储用户名

java: LinkedHashMap containsKey=true 但 get 返回 null

java - Groovy中HashMap的点积

java - 如何将 url 输出(JSON)作为 Java 变量

java - 使用 Java 通过带有证书的 https 使用 RESTful 服务

java - 如何对 LinkedHashMap Arraylist<LinkedHashMap<String,String> 的 Arraylist 进行排序?

java - 如何访问 LinkedHashMap 中嵌套对象的数据

java - 即使使用 java 结果集具有不同的数据,相同的数据也会插入到 Excel 的每一行中